Lemon Lush Recipe

  • Prep Time: 25 minutes
  • Cook Time: 15 minutes
  • Total Time: 4 hours 40 minutes (including chilling)
  • Yield: 12 servings

Description

Lemon Lush is a delightful no-bake layered dessert featuring a buttery pecan crust, creamy sweetened cream cheese layer, tangy instant lemon pudding, and fluffy whipped topping. Perfectly chilled, this refreshing dessert offers a bright citrus flavor balanced with creamy textures, making it a crowd-pleaser for gatherings and special occasions.


Ingredients

Crust:

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1/2 cup chopped pecans

Cream Cheese Layer:

  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 1 cup whipped topping (such as Cool Whip)

Lemon Layer:

  • 2 boxes (3.4 oz each) instant lemon pudding mix
  • 3 cups cold milk

Topping:

  • 2 cups whipped topping
  • Optional: lemon zest or slices for garnish


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) to prepare for baking the crust.
  2. Prepare Crust Mixture: In a medium b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, softened unsalted butter, and chopped pecans. Mix these ingredients until the mixture becomes crumbly and well combined.
  3. Bake Crust: Press the crumbly mixture evenly into the bottom of a 9Ă—13-inch baking dish to form a firm crust. Bake for 15 to 18 minutes or until the crust turns lightly golden brown. Once baked, remove from the oven and let it cool completely to room temperature.
  4. Make Cream Cheese Layer: In a m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ese and powdered sugar together until the mixture is smooth and creamy. Gently fold in 1 cup of whipped topping until well incorporated. Spread this cream cheese mixture evenly over the cooled crust.
  5. Prepare Lemon Pudding: In a separate bowl, whisk together the two boxes of instant lemon pudding mix with 3 cups of cold milk. Whisk for about 2 minutes or until the pudding thickens. Spread this thickened lemon pudding evenly over the cream cheese layer.
  6. Add Topping: Spread the remaining 2 cups of whipped topping evenly over the lemon pudding layer, smoothing the surface with a spatula.
  7. Chill to Set: Refrigerate the assembled dessert for at least 4 hours or overnight to allow it to set firmly and for the flavors to meld.
  8. Garnish and Serve: Before serving, optionally garnish the top with fresh lemon zest or lemon slices to add a bright citrus aroma and attractive presentation.

Notes

  • Be sure to let the crust cool completely before adding the cream cheese layer to prevent melting and sliding.
  • Use cold milk for the pudding mix to ensure proper thickening.
  • For a nut-free version, omit the chopped pecans from the crust and replace with additional flour or graham cracker crumbs.
  • Chilling overnight enhances the flavor and texture of the dessert.
  • If you prefer a stronger lemon flavor, add a teaspoon of lemon zest to the pudding layer.
